SaleHoo Cruise Deals

Off season cruises – The off seasons for various cruise lines change in accordance to the specific part of the world they frequent, but by doing research and figuring out when these times are, you can find some great deals because cruise lines lower their prices during the off season due to reduced travel traffic.

Go to the Caribbean – Generally, cruises heading to the Caribbean are a lot cheaper than cruises that explore Europe. Caribbean cruises are not only cheap, but offer numerous beautiful islands and cultures to explore, plus travelling off the boat in Caribbean ports is a much cheaper travel experience than those found with the hefty Euro.
 
Search for package offers – A variety of unique packaged offers are available on a constantly rotating basis for different travel destinations and cruise lines.  If you can find these offers they are usually the best way to travel because they package together a mixture of hotel and other accommodations with normal cruise trips. The problem with these packages is they are often hard to find and get used up quickly. Inaugural cruises – When a new ship is sent out for its first cruise there are often a variety of excellent deals and offers designed to get people to join the new ship on its maiden voyage. Take advantage of these deals and enjoy a nice inaugural cruise packed with discounted prices.

Repositioning cruises
– Cruise lines sometimes have to send ships designed for one destination to a different one to make up for demand. This means that a Swedish Cruise ship may be sent down to Hawaii to meet travel needs. This happens more than you would think, and cruise lines try and make up for this exchange by offering reduced prices.

Book too early or too late – This is one of the golden rules of travel and applies for almost everything. Book trips outside of normal times to find the best ticket deals. By booking way early or extremely last minute, the cheapest deals will often reveal themselves and make extravagant cruises affordable at minimum cost.

Stay in Low Cabins – The higher up on a cruise ship your accommodations physically reach, the more expensive they will be, so book a lower deck cabin to save money. If you really want to save, book an inside cabin, those are even cheaper.

Loyalty – Once you pick a cruise line to utilize, be sure to stick with them. Cruise lines reward returning customers with exciting deals and cheap offers.
